Genealogy Richard Remmé, The Hague, Netherlands » Elizabeth Brereton (± 1505-> 1545)

Personal data Elizabeth Brereton 

Sources 1, 2, 3, 4Sources 5, 6
  • Alternative name: Elizabeth Brereton
  • She was born about 1505 in Malpas, Cheshire, England, Great Britain.
  • She died after November 30, 1545 in Cheshire, England.
  • A child of Randall Brereton and Eleanor Dutton
  • This information was last updated on December 4, 2022.

Household of Elizabeth Brereton

(1) She is married to Randle Mainwaring.

They got married about 1520.


Child(ren):

  1. Phillip Mainwaring  ± 1530-1573 
  2. Elizabeth Mainwaring  ± 1530-± 1601 


(2) She is married to Richard Shakerley.

They got married about 1509.
